About a year ago, I accepted the position of Camp Director at Sunshine Cove Christian Camp in Union, MI.  Sunshine Cove is owned and operated by Sunshine Gospel Ministry of Chicago (SGM).  The decision was made to close camp.

However, To God Be The Glory, Great Things He Hath Done!   After some long days, and much prayer, the camp has been given a new lease on life.  SGM is willing to work with us to get the camp back up and running. 

Our summer camp ministry focuses on serving young people that would not otherwise be able to attend camp due to financial reasons.  Typically, we send our bus into some of the toughest neighborhoods in Chicago, and bring back a group of children yearning just to get out of the city.  They are able to run and play freely at camp which includes swimming, sharing around a campfire, high energy games, but most importantly surrounded by a staff that loves and cares for each one of them.  We also serve other ministries closer to camp so they too can enjoy what God has provided, which allows us to reach an even wider diversity of underprivileged children.  This past summer, out of 254 summer campers 77 accepted Jesus Christ as Lord and Savior of their lives.  We need this to continue.
